# #691641

A color — warm, vivid, dark, playful, bold, luxury. Deterministic analysis from BrandSweets (no inference).

## Values

- Hex: `#691641`
- RGB: rgb(105, 22, 65)
- HSL: hsl(329, 65%, 25%)
- OKLCH: oklch(0.357 0.123 353.7)
- Relative luminance: 0.0396
- Nearest named color: Bordeaux (#7b002c, Δ 5.068) — https://brandsweets.com/colors/bordeaux
- Moods: warm, vivid, dark, playful, bold, luxury

## Contrast (WCAG 2.x, as text)

- On white (#ffffff): 11.72:1 — AA pass, AA-large pass, AAA pass
- On black (#000000): 1.79:1 — AA fail, AA-large fail, AAA fail. Fix: AA: text → #d33185 (4.55:1); AA: background → #a1a1a1 (4.54:1); AAA: text → #e170aa (7.1:1); AAA: background → #c9c9c9 (7.08:1)
